Signs Of A Leaky Roof
Water stains, mold, or dampness on ceilings and walls may indicate leaks.
Common Causes Of Roof Leaks
Damaged shingles, flashing issues, or clogged gutters can lead to roof leaks.

Leaky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s of a leaky roof? Water stains on ceilings, missing shingles, and mold growth are common indicators of roof leaks.
How does roof replacement address leaks? Replacing the roof removes damaged materials and installs a new, watertight barrier to prevent future leaks.
Can a ro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or leaks and damage can sometimes be repaired, but extensive or recurring leaks often require full replacement.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for replacement? As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and other durable materials are commonly used for roof replacements in the area.
